There is an easier way. The seventh annual Battle Creek Shred Day is set for this Saturday, April 18 from 10am to noon in the parking lot behind Commerce Point in downtown Battle Creek. Up to five boxes of paper with sensitive material ready for shredding may be brought per person. There is no charge, though the organizers ask that folks bring  a non-perishable food item to benefit the Food Bank of South Central Michigan.
